Floor Joist Repair in Conroe, TX
Floor joist repair services address issues related to the structural supports beneath floors, ensuring stability and safety within a home. These repairs typically involve replacing or reinforcing damaged or rotted joists caused by moisture, pests, or age-related wear. Projects may include restoring sagging floors, eliminating creaking sounds, or preparing a property for remodeling. Homeowners often seek this service when noticing uneven flooring, visible signs of damage, or concerns about the integrity of the floor system before undertaking renovation or repair projects.
Property owners should understand that floor joist repair involves assessing the extent of damage, selecting appropriate repair methods, and ensuring the structural soundness of the floor system. It's important to consider factors such as the age of the building, the cause of the damage, and the materials involved. Proper repair can help prevent further deterioration, improve safety, and maintain the value of the property. Contacting a professional for an evaluation can provide clarity on the scope of work needed for a safe and durable solution.

Signs Of Floor Joist Damage
Uneven flooring, sagging, or creaking may indicate compromised joists needing repair.
Common Causes Of Joist Issues
Water damage, age, and structural shifts can weaken floor joists over time.
Repair And Reinforcement Options
Solutions include sistering, jacking, or replacing damaged joists to restore stability.

Floor Joist Repair Questions
What are signs of damaged floor joists? Indicators include sagging floors, creaking sounds, and visible cracks or gaps in the flooring or walls.
Why is floor joist repair important? Repairing damaged joists helps maintain the structural integrity of a building and prevents further damage or safety hazards.
What causes floor joist damage? Common causes include moisture exposure, wood rot, pest infestation, and age-related wear and tear.
Can damaged floor joists be repaired? Yes, repairs typically involve sistering, reinforcement, or replacement of affected joists to restore stability.
